S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: Purpose: The Advisory Committee to the Director, CDC, shall advise the Secretary, HHS, and the Director, CDC, on policy and broad strategies that will enable CDC to fulfill its mission of protecting health through health promotion, prevention, and preparedness. The committee recommends ways to prioritize CDC's activities, improve results, and address health disparities. It also provides guidance to help CDC work more effectively with its various private and public sector constituents to make health protection a practical reality. Matters to be Considered: The agenda will include discussions regarding CDC's current and future work in the following topic areas: (1) data modernization; (2) laboratory quality; and (3) health equity. The ACD will hear reports from its working groups on these three topics. In addition, the ACD will have presentations on the COVID-19 and Monkeypox responses, Social Determinants of Health and CDC's Moving Forward initiative. Agenda items are subject to change as priorities dictate.
